Job Title: Logistics Lead
Role Overview
The Logistics Lead is responsible for establishing, managing, and scaling the end-to-end logistics function for an export focused manufacturing organization operating within controlled goods, export controls, battery shipping standards, and global trade regulations.

This role is responsible for executing inbound and outbound logistics activities, implementing scalable processes and systems, and ensuring compliant, cost-effective, and reliable material flow—from suppliers to manufacturing and from finished goods to customers worldwide.

Scope of Role & Expected Growth Path
Phase 1: Onboarding

Take direct ownership of day-to-day inbound and outbound logistics execution.

Phase 2: Process Maturity & Expertise

Develop deep expertise in all logistics, trade, and regulatory requirements impacting the business.

Design and implement standardized logistics processes, documentation, and governance to support scaling.

Optimize use of ERP and shipping systems to improve efficiency, accuracy, and compliance.

Clearly define Logistics’ role and handoffs with Procurement, Production, Engineering, and Sales.

Phase 3: Strategy, Growth & Leadership

Own the company’s logistics strategy aligned to growth, risk management, and cost optimization.

Manage external service providers.

Lead continuous improvement initiatives, KPI performance management, and cross-functional alignment.

Key Responsibilities
Outbound Logistics

Book shipments and select appropriate carriers and freight forwarders.

Optimize transportation mode, routing, and cost based on service, compliance, and customer requirements.

Prepare, review, and maintain accurate export documentation, including:

Commercial invoices

Packing lists

Certificates of origin

USMCA/NAFTA documentation

Dangerous goods declarations

Export licenses where applicable

Ensure appropriate cargo insurance coverage and manage freight claims.

Inbound Logistics





Schedule and track inbound raw materials and components.

Coordinate receiving schedules, ASNs (Advanced Shipping Notices), and dock availability.

Manage customs clearance in coordination with brokers, including HTS classification and import documentation.

Monitor supplier Incoterms, delivery performance, and freight exceptions.

Resolve delays, discrepancies, and damage claims.

Define explicit handoff points and ownership between Logistics and Procurement.

Compliance, Controlled Goods & Dangerous Goods

Establish and maintain compliant processes for export controls and controlled goods, including:

Jurisdiction and classification

Licensing and recordkeeping

End-use and end-user screening

Oversee battery and dangerous goods compliance, including:

UN 38.3 testing documentation

IATA DGR, IMDG Code, and applicable labeling and packaging requirements

SDS management and certification tracking

Deliver internal training and updates to relevant teams (e.g., Production, Engineering, PLM) as regulations change.

Proactively advise Production and Engineering on regulatory changes that may impact existing or future products.

Inventory Movement, Systems & Documentation

Own logistics-related data integrity within ERP and shipping systems.

Ensure accurate transaction records for inventory movement, imports, exports, and compliance documentation.

Develop and maintain logistics SOPs, work instructions, and policies.

Maintain audit-ready documentation and records retention.

Supplier & Partner Management

Select, onboard, and manage relationships with:

Freight forwarders

Carriers

Customs brokers

Insurance providers

Negotiate rates, service-level agreements (SLAs), capacity, and value-added services (e.g., packing, labeling, consolidation).

Monitor partner performance and drive continuous improvement.

Performance Metrics & Reporting

Develop, track, and communicate key logistics KPIs, such as:

On-time delivery

Cost per shipment

Compliance exceptions

Transit time variability
